Nederlandse HowTo voor Google Nest SDM App

De protects draaien ondertussen in test.

Martin Verbeek

2 Likes

Google SDM App 5.1.0 staat op de community store. Initieel Nest Protect Support aanwezig. Om het te activeren: ga naar de app, selecteer de Nest Protect tab, click op request code, copy-/paste de code die je krijgt na de nodige vragen in het veld en click Save. Het duurt ongeveer 20 seconden voordat alles goed staat. Dus wacht even voor je devices toe gaat voegen.

hoor graag of het werkt (met name V1 als die al niet expired zijn) want ik heb alleen V2´s. En wat er eventueel niet goed is en additionele zaken die je mist, of graag zou willen zien.

Hi @Martin_Verbeek ,
Dank voor de uitgebreide handleiding. Ik zit echter vast bij Google Nest login stap 2. Daar geeft Google aan ‘No access to partner’. Heb jij enig idee wat ik verkeerd doe?
Dank, Jeroen

Hi Jeroen, dit krijg ik als ik op de fout zoek.

Information could not be retrieved. Please contact PARTNER to verify that your account has been properly set up. You may need to add the developer email address as a home member in the Google Home app settings. This version of the error applies to the Device Access Sandbox and occurs when the Google account used with PCM is not an authorized account on the structure being linked. Make sure the Google account is a member of the home listed in the Google Home app.

Martin Verbeek

Indien mensen alleen Nest Protect hebben dan hoef je alleen de Nest Protect tab in te vullen, de andere setup voor SDM is niet nodig

Goedemiddag Martin,

Hier heb ik m’n 3 protects (v.2) zonder problemen kunnen toevoegen.
Geweldig! Ontzettend bedankt!!

1 Like

Super Martin, hier ook zonder problemen drie stuks toegevoegd :muscle:t3:

1 Like

Hi Martin. Ik begrijp nu dat ik iets van HCS moet installeren voor ik SDM kan downloaden. Weet jij waar ik de HCS software kan downloaden?

Rechtsboven op de HCS pagina staat een groen vlak, kwartcirkel, met drie schuine strepen. Klik die, dan staat er aan de linker bovenhoek een teken, klik die dan kom je op de install page waar je de software kunt downloaden etc…

Thanks! Gevonden. Alleen tijdens installatie blijft tie aangeven: Please wait while the app is being installed…

Lijkt niet door te lopen. Mocht iemand hier nog een oplossing voor hebben? Is het programma compatibel met Windows 11?

Geen idee, zoek even op forum naar Max van der Laar (maker HCS) of op Slack. Die weet het vast.

Martin Verbeek

Over ongeveer een week komt versie 5.2.0 uit. Het volgende is nieuw:

OnDemand snapshots voor devices die dat ondersteunen.
Bekend gezicht detectie voor devices die dat ondersteunen, je kunt nu een bekend gezicht selecteren in de alarm_person trigger (of A Known Face, of Any Face). Check je flows als deze update uitkomt!

Aanpassingen die te maken hebben met capabilities die battery powered devices (niet) hebben.

app heeft de hele dag prima gewerkt, kreeg alleen de deurbel niet goed werkend. na wat spelen werkte de app niet meer. homey zelf geeft aan ‘‘the app Goggle Nest SDM has stopped working’’

ik moest alle settings opnieuw goedzetten, krijg nu alleen bij de oath2 instellingen de volgende melding:
image
iemand enig idee hoe je dit oplost?

edit: om de en of andere reden selecteerd die niet automatisch het project…

Edit2: na een herinstall van de app doet die dit wel goed.

Ik heb zo’n idee dat het vandaag overal niet helemaal lekker liep. Vrij veel performance problemen met Homey of Google.

Ik zie dat het project undefined is dus waarschijnlijk is het GCP project id niet ingevuld of zo.

Martin Verbeek

ik heb een nieuw project aangemaakt en alles is nu koppelbaar. deurbel geeft alleen motion person en geluid niet door. ook als de deurbel naar de camera wilt gaan (hoeft niet) doet die zelf. dan crasht de app en moet die opnieuw opgestart worden. het log daarbij is wel interessant .

Heeft idd met elkaar te maken, tijdens het ophalen van de foto gaat er wat fout. Zie je voor die rode errors nog andere meldingen?

Martin Verbeek


hmm er zit een uur tijdsverschil in?

2022-02-07 21:40:51 createCloud() created true
2022-02-07 21:40:20 [Driver:doorbell] [Device:f9ae0bca-e437-4d08-918b-fea98b4f0a5a] onOAuth2Init() → success
2022-02-07 21:40:20 [res] { ok: true, status: 200, statusText: ‘OK’ }
2022-02-07 21:40:18 Subscription success : isSubscriptionOkay() Push subscription and Endpoint, Pull subscription, all checked and OK
2022-02-07 21:40:18 [req] Authorization: Bearer ya29.A0ARrdaM8cpPql3AoUVm5NyGr2kOtHLlwDpoJZybnfQyEDvQRj4LKnsw2uPrYWCYafiYY-RhurnjkdmOq45ESX2vpeygXzOiR4ncQFF1q90bEUmQ79HUbyTnhHWDqp2mpJZ_sAJByHS6J6bpWc2CuqFcPLzVyo
2022-02-07 21:40:18 [req] GET https://smartdevicemanagement.googleapis.com/v1/enterprises/31c19c07-48ab-4089-af69-9352bf900a15/devices/AVPHwEvGbdH5rhhSSUG2jM-a2WM6HW6XEL3igcCcGg0UL46anX-GsP0ts1JvbvlCoooJaQZ3mIwC2Ha5bFnazw7oMoXtZQ
2022-02-07 21:40:18 [res] { ok: true, status: 200, statusText: ‘OK’ }
2022-02-07 21:40:17 authNestProtect() { error: ‘invalid_grant’, error_description: ‘Bad Request’ }
2022-02-07 21:40:17 setHomeyWebhook() → created webHook
2022-02-07 20:40:17 [ManagerDrivers] [Driver:doorbell] [Device:f9ae0bca-e437-4d08-918b-fea98b4f0a5a] Error: ENOENT: no such file or directory, access ‘/userdata/chimeenterprises_31c19c07_48ab_4089_af69_9352bf900a15_devices_avphwevgbdh5rhhssug2jm_a2wm6hw6xel3igcccgg0ul46anx_gsp0ts1jvbvlcooojaqz3miwc2ha5bfnazw7omoxtzq.nst’ at Object.accessSync (fs.js:203:3) at /lib/NestCameraDevice.js:67:8 at new Promise () at DoorbellDevice.setImage (/lib/NestCameraDevice.js:64:10) at /lib/NestCameraDevice.js:420:12 at Array.forEach () at /lib/NestCameraDevice.js:419:38 at new Promise () at DoorbellDevice.connectImages (/lib/NestCameraDevice.js:415:10) at DoorbellDevice.onOAuth2Init (/lib/NestCameraDevice.js:54:9) { errno: -2, syscall: ‘access’, code: ‘ENOENT’, path: ‘/userdata/chimeenterprises_31c19c07_48ab_4089_af69_9352bf900a15_devices_avphwevgbdh5rhhssug2jm_a2wm6hw6xel3igcccgg0ul46anx_gsp0ts1jvbvlcooojaqz3miwc2ha5bfnazw7omoxtzq.nst’ }
2022-02-07 21:40:17 [req] Authorization: Bearer ya29.A0ARrdaM8cpPql3AoUVm5NyGr2kOtHLlwDpoJZybnfQyEDvQRj4LKnsw2uPrYWCYafiYY-RhurnjkdmOq45ESX2vpeygXzOiR4ncQFF1q90bEUmQ79HUbyTnhHWDqp2mpJZ_sAJByHS6J6bpWc2CuqFcPLzVyo
2022-02-07 21:40:17 [req] GET https://pubsub.googleapis.com/v1/projects/homey-sdm-340420/subscriptions
2022-02-07 21:40:17 [Driver:doorbell] [Device:f9ae0bca-e437-4d08-918b-fea98b4f0a5a] registerListeners()
2022-02-07 21:40:17 [Driver:doorbell] [Device:f9ae0bca-e437-4d08-918b-fea98b4f0a5a] onOAuth2Init()
2022-02-07 21:40:17 [Driver:doorbell] [Device:f9ae0bca-e437-4d08-918b-fea98b4f0a5a] onInit sound events enabled: TRUE, motion events enabled: TRUE
2022-02-07 21:40:17 [Driver:doorbell] onOAuth2Init() → success
2022-02-07 21:40:17 [Driver:doorbell] onOAuth2Init()
2022-02-07 21:40:17 Create Cloud success : true
2022-02-07 21:40:17 [Driver:protect] Init Driver Nest Protect
2022-02-07 21:40:17 [Driver:thermostat] onOAuth2Init() → success
2022-02-07 21:40:17 [Driver:thermostat] onOAuth2Init()
2022-02-07 21:40:17 [Driver:hub] onOAuth2Init() → success
2022-02-07 21:40:17 [Driver:hub] onOAuth2Init()
2022-02-07 21:40:17 [Driver:camera] onOAuth2Init() → success
2022-02-07 21:40:17 [Driver:camera] onOAuth2Init()
2022-02-07 21:40:17 createCloud() created true
2022-02-07 21:40:17 [dbg] [NestOAuth2Client] [c:default] [s:b7e02873-b795-4009-926a-cb0ccd1a91d1] Initialized
2022-02-07 21:40:17 Google Nest SDM 5.1.0 has initialised.
2022-02-07 21:40:17 setOAuth2ConfigNest() Set Nest Device Access Config
2022-02-07 21:40:17 capturing stderr
2022-02-07 21:40:17 capturing stdout

na het proberen te openen van de camera chrast de app

image

ok detecteerd die verder niets.

Iemand enig idee van bovenstaande?

Device denkt dat ie een foto van iemand heeft die op de bel heeft gedrukt. Maar het aanmaken van de foto is in het proces ooit ergens fout gegaan. De app check de file en geeft de error in de log, ziet er wild uit maar app gaat door, druk op de bel dan wordt er volgens mij een nieuwe file aangemaakt en gaat ie voortaan goed. Of het gaat altijd fout met aanmaken, dan wil ik graag een stukje van de log.
Is het een Battery doorbell???

Het is een battery doorbell maar altijd aangesloten

zojuist getest en het gaat na iedere keer op de deurbel drukken fout. de app crasht ook op dat moment en soms moet ik de app herstartten omdat die zijn gegevens dan kwijt is.

ik heb het hele Log naar je in een PM gestuurd